DERS BİLGİLERİ
Ders Kodu Yarıyıl Ders Süresi Kredi AKTS
Bilgisayar Programlama 2 ISB   244 4 2 3 5

Ön Koşul Dersleri Yok
Ders Hakkında Önerilen Diğer Hususlar None

Dersin Dili Türkçe
Dersin Seviyesi Lisans
Dersin Türü Zorunlu
Dersin Koordinatörü Öğr. Gör. Erkan KAYNAK
Dersi Verenler
Öğr. Gör.ERKAN KAYNAK1. Öğretim Grup:A
 
Dersin Yardımcıları
Dersin Amacı
c sharp programlama dilini kullanmayı öğretmek, uygulama kapasitesini ve yeteneğini yükseltmek.
Dersin İçeriği
c sharp programlama dilinde dosya işlemleri, Kolleksiyonlar. Stream kullanımı. Nesneye yönelik programlama.

Dersin Öğrenme Kazanımları
1) İleri c sharp programlama dilinde kod yazar.
2) c sharp programlama dili ile bilgisayarda bulunan dosyalara erişir..
3) Yeni bir dosya yaratıp, var olan dosyaları siler..
4) c sharp programlama dilini kullanarak bir dosya üzerine veri yazar..
5) c sharp dilindeki koleksiyon sınıflarını kullanır.
6) Nesneye Yönelik programlamayı kavrar.
7) Kapsülleme ve Kalıtım konularını kavrar.
8) c sharp dilinde Nesneye yönelik programlama yapar.
9)
10)
11)
12)
13)
14)
15)


DERSİN PROGRAM KAZANIMLARINA KATKISI
NoTemel öğrenme KazanımlarıKatkı Düzeyi
12345
1
Olasılık, İstatistik ve Matematiğin temel kavram ve ilkelerini açıklar
2
Yaşamda istatistiğin yerini ve önemini belirtir
3
İktisadi ve hukuksal temel kavram ve ilkeleri tanımlar
4
Karşılaşılabileceği sorunlar karşısında, sayısal ve istatistiksel çözümler üretir
5
İstatistiksel verilerin elde edilmesi ve/veya düzenlenmesi için uygun yöntem ve teknikleri kullanır
6
Bilgisayar sistemlerini ve programlarını kullanır
7
Matematiksel ve istatistiksel teknikleri kullanarak rasgelelik içeren problemlere model kurma, çözme ve yorumlama
8
İstatistiksel analiz yöntemlerini uygular
9
İstatistiksel sonuç çıkarım (tahmin, hipotez testi, v.b.) yapar
10
İstatistiksel teknikleri kullanarak farklı disiplinlerin problemlerine çözüm üretir
11
Görsel, veritabanı ve web programlama tekniklerini anlar ve nesnel program yazabilme yeteneğine sahip olur
12
İstatistiksel paket programları kullanarak model oluşturur ve analiz yapar
13
İstatistiksel metotlar arasındaki farkı ayırt eder
14
İstatistik ile ilişkili disiplinler arasındaki etkileşimin farkında olur
15
İstatistiksel yöntemleri kullanarak elde edilen sonuçları sözlü ve görsel olarak sunar
16
Bireysel ve ortaklaşa olarak etkili ve üretken çalışma yapma becerisine sahip olur
17
Mesleki gelişimlerinin yanı sıra ilgi ve yetenekleri doğrultusunda bilimsel, kültürel, sanatsal ve sosyal alanlarda eğitim gereksinimlerini belirleyerek kendini sürekli geliştirir
18
İstatistiğin kullanıldığı bilim alanları ile ilgili verilerin toplanması, yorumlanması, duyurulması aşamalarında toplumsal, bilimsel ve etik değerlere sahip olur.

DERS AKIŞI
HaftaKonularÖn Hazırlık Yöntem
1 c sharp programlama dilinde yeni bir dosya oluşturulması ve kayıt girilmesi. liter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
2 c sharp programlama dilinde kayıt işlemleri ve hesaplamalar. liter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
3 c sharp programlama dilinde dosyalara kayıt eklemesi ve kayıt görüntülenmesi. liter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
4 c sharp programlama dilinde dosyalarda kayıt aranması ve kayıt görüntülenmesi. liter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
5 Nesneye Yönetik Programlamaya Giriş liter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
6 Sınıflar liter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
7 Kapsülleme ve Kalıtım liter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
8 Ara Sınav Genel Tekrrar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
9 Nesneye yönelik programlamada poliforizma literatur taraması Anlatım
Alıştırma ve Uygulama
Ödev
10 Yapılandırıcı Metodlar liter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
11 Statik Metodlar liter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
12 İsim Uzayları liter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
13 Koleksiyon Sınıfları - I liter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
14 Koleksiyon Sınıfları - II liter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
15 Streamler literatur taraması Anlatım
Alıştırma ve Uygulama
Proje / Tasarım
16-17 Yarıyıl Sonu Sınavları literatur taraması Yazılı Sınav

KAYNAKLAR
Ders Notu
Diğer Kaynaklar